How does the ceiling fans controller perform in terms of energy saving?

Publish Time: 2025-03-24
The performance of ceiling fan controller in energy saving is quite remarkable. It realizes the refined management of energy by intelligently controlling the speed and operation status of ceiling fans, thus achieving the goal of energy saving and emission reduction.

Ceiling fan controller is usually equipped with multi-speed adjustment function, and users can choose the appropriate speed according to actual needs. In the hot summer, by increasing the speed of ceiling fans, the circulation of indoor air can be accelerated, the human comfort can be improved, and the dependence on refrigeration equipment such as air conditioners can be reduced, thereby saving energy. When the temperature is moderate or slight ventilation is required, reducing the speed of ceiling fans can also achieve energy saving effects. The intelligent speed adjustment function enables ceiling fans to automatically adjust the speed according to environmental changes and user needs to achieve reasonable use of energy.

Some ceiling fan controllers also support the reversal function of ceiling fans. In winter, by reversing the ceiling fan blades, the air can flow downward, forming a heating effect, helping to increase the indoor temperature and reduce the need for heating. This reversal function not only improves the utilization rate of ceiling fans, but also further promotes energy conservation.

Frequency conversion speed regulation technology is an important technology in modern ceiling fan controllers. By changing the motor power supply frequency through the inverter, the speed of the ceiling fan can be precisely controlled. Variable frequency speed regulation not only provides a wider range of speed options, but also effectively reduces energy consumption and noise. When running at low speed, the energy consumption of variable frequency speed ceiling fans is much lower than that of traditional ceiling fans, which enables ceiling fans to save a lot of energy during long-term use.

Some advanced ceiling fan controllers also have intelligent control strategies, such as automatically adjusting the speed of ceiling fans according to indoor temperature and humidity, or linking with smart home systems to automatically adjust the operating status of ceiling fans according to users' activity habits and work and rest time. These intelligent control strategies can further optimize the energy utilization efficiency of ceiling fans and achieve more accurate energy saving effects.

The design of ceiling fans controllers is usually compatible with multiple types of motors, including traditional AC motors and more efficient brushless DC motors (BLDC motors). By adapting BLDC motors, ceiling fans controllers can significantly improve energy efficiency and reduce energy consumption. BLDC motors have higher energy conversion efficiency and can consume less electricity at the same output power, so they are one of the important ways to achieve energy saving in ceiling fans.
